LA Auto Present: shiny vehicles, misplaced status

Editorial Board Published December 7, 2025
Share
LA Auto Present: shiny vehicles, misplaced status
SHARE

LA Auto Present: shiny vehicles, misplaced status

Curiousity a few single automobile, the prototype “runabout,” offered by Ransom Eli Olds, attracted 10,000 paying prospects in 1900 on the first automotive present. It was held in Madison Sq. Backyard in New York, the enduring indoor area in downtown Manhattan. Attendees paid 50 cents.

Earlier than the Los Angeles and Detroit reveals arrived seven years later, Olds Motor Car Firm of Lansing, Mich., constructed 425 Oldsmobiles, making it the nation’s first automaker to supply vehicles in quantity.

Regardless of interruptions by wars and illness, the auto present custom grew. Producers started showcasing autos on to customers, a stress-free various to the as soon as extra outstanding aggressive salesmanship at dealerships.

The primary LA Auto Present featured 99 autos on an ice-skating rink. It grew, organizers tout, to greater than 1,000 vehicles and vehicles and business shows. However on the lately concluded version, which ended its 10-day run Nov. 30, the legacy of auto reveals appeared additional diminished.

COVID-19’s lingering results and the 2023 United Auto Employees strike impacted many industries, together with automotive. The LA Auto Present was cancelled in 2020 and rescheduled twice.

The present lastly returned in November 2021, bringing renewed enthusiasm. Since then, finances cuts have led a number of mainstay producers to overlook subsequent reveals.

This 12 months, the Los Angeles Conference Heart halls, as soon as energetic with rotating platforms and expansive lineups, appeared and felt underwhelming.

Audi, BMW, and Mercedes-Benz didn’t attend. Porsche, as soon as in its personal small corridor, occupied a smaller open area with fewer autos. Indoor driving tracks filled-in areas as soon as occupied by carmakers’ full lineups.

Basic Motors positioned Buick, Cadillac, and GMC pickup vehicles from an area dealership in a poorly deliberate, poorly lit nook close to the primary entrance.

Automotive spokesperson-ambassadors, generally known as the Sirens of Chrome, had been additionally principally absent. Whereas the custom, particularly notable within the entertainment-focused Los Angeles space, could not be socially acceptable, it as soon as helped outline the present. Satirically, a collection of pictures of ladies in tight-fitting apparel, posing suggestively on vehicles to advertise an automotive laptop accent, hung in a conference middle breezeway.

Mannequin world debuts, as soon as frequent in Los Angeles, at the moment are rare. Idea autos, previously key occasion highlights, are additionally much less widespread.

Since 2016, the LA Auto Present has included AutoMobility, an business and media occasion earlier than the general public present. It was decreased from two days to 1, and this 12 months’s program spotlighted area of interest areas corresponding to zero-emissions and next-generation AI. Not too long ago, many producers have prioritized off-site, invite-only occasions.

Regardless of the adjustments, spectacular autos remained on show, with robust showings from Ford, Honda, Hyundai, Kia and others. Subaru returned with its long-running interactive canine adoption program amid its new autos. Rivian, in its fifth 12 months, showcased a stealth camper tent and a two-burner induction cooktop for its new pickups.

After which there was Honda. It debuted the Afeela, a high-tech, all-electric sedan developed by Sony Honda Mobility in Beverly Hills. The sensor-overloaded car’s California-only distribution is projected for mid-2026.

However even Honda, a legacy LA Auto Present participant, had points. With its United States headquarters in close by Torrance, the carmaker had a full lineup on show on the conference middle. A number of public relations representatives additionally attended the reception, highlighting the Afeela. That they had loads to advertise in regards to the two-trim car with a top-line MSRP of $102,900.

However a disc jockey performed bass-heavy music too loudly, typically muddling Honda presenters’ efforts to debate the brand new car’s function and future.

With out the overbearing music, the identical query faces LA Auto Present organizers.
